Chessable Masters: Artemiev leads Group A

6/21/2020 – Vladislav Artemiev kicked off the first day of the preliminaries with two whites and two wins at the Chessable Masters. He drew the remaining three games of the day to finish in the sole lead with 3½ points. The winner of the previous event of the ‘Magnus Carlsen Tour’, Daniil Dubov, is in sole second place a half point behind — the Russian defeated Magnus Carlsen in round 4. | Photo: Patricia Claros Aguilar

Face to face: The Croatian Championship 2020

6/19/2020 – The Croatian Chess Federation is the first to organise a "real" chess tournament after the worldwide Corona Lockdown. From June 19 to 29, twelve players will meet face to face in the Croatian Championship. Host of the event is the town of Vinkovci where Bobby Fischer won a strong international tournament in 1968.

125 years Swiss System

6/17/2020 – It is not difficult to guess who invented the Swiss system. Yes, indeed, you guessed right: the Swiss did. To be more precise: the inventor is Dr. Julius Müller, a teacher by profession. The official birth date of the still popular and successful system is June 15, 1895, its birthplace is Zurich.

Keres wins AVRO Tournament!

6/16/2020 – Before the 14th and final round of the AVRO tournament, Paul Keres and Reuben Fine shared first place with 8.0/13 each. And as chance would have it, they had to play against each other in the final round. However, their game was not particularly exciting but ended in a draw after only 19 moves – which was good for Keres who won the tournament on tiebreak. After this outstanding success, the 22-year-old Estonian can hope for a World Championship match against Alexander Alekhine. | Photo: Valter Heuer (Archive)
